Cicinho vê risco de eliminação do Flamengo: “Tenho minhas dúvidas”

Cicinho sobre o Flamengo no programa Jogo Aberto

O ex-lateral Cicinho fez um alerta ao Flamengo antes do confronto decisivo contra o Racing, pela semifinal da Copa Libertadore nesta quarta-feira, 22 de outubro, no Maracanã. Durante o programa “Jogo Aberto”, da Band, o ex-jogador afirmou que o desempenho do time carioca na atual edição do torneio preocupa.

Para o ex-lateral, a forma como o Flamengo sofreu na fase de grupos foi fora do normal. Segundo Cicinho, o elenco é forte demais para ter enfrentado tanta dificuldade.

“O Flamengo tem que ter tirado lições. A dificuldade que o time encontrou nessa Libertadores, com o elenco que tem, não é normal. Era para ter passado em primeiro lugar com tranquilidade. Não havia necessidade de sofrer tanto”, afirmou.

Críticas ao desempenho fora de casa

Cicinho também destacou a diferença de rendimento entre os jogos no Maracanã e as partidas fora do Rio. O comentarista afirmou que o Flamengo precisa aprender a administrar resultados longe de casa e se manter equilibrado quando é pressionado.

“O Flamengo tem tido dificuldade para administrar resultados. Em casa, faz grandes jogos. Mas fora de casa, o time cai muito. Se o primeiro jogo fosse lá e o segundo aqui, eu diria que estaria classificado. Agora, jogando o segundo fora, tenho minhas dúvidas”, analisou.

O ex-jogador reforçou que o clube tem potencial para vencer o Racing, mas precisa lidar melhor com situações adversas. Segundo ele, a equipe demonstra fragilidade quando sofre pressão, especialmente em estádios hostis.

Desempenho do Flamengo na Libertadores

O Flamengo chega às quartas após uma campanha irregular. O time teve uma fase de grupos marcada por oscilações e classificações apertadas. Mesmo assim, conseguiu eliminar o Internacional nas oitavas e o Estudiantes nas quartas, garantindo a vaga nas semifinais com muito drama.

Contra os argentinos, a classificação veio nos pênaltis, com o goleiro Rossi como herói. O arqueiro defendeu duas cobranças e garantiu a passagem para a próxima fase. Apesar da emoção, o desempenho deixou dúvidas sobre a consistência do time de Filipe Luís fora de casa.

Cicinho ressaltou que o Flamengo precisa mostrar mais controle emocional e coletividade. Para ele, o talento individual não basta em mata-matas equilibrados. “O elenco é muito bom, mas o time precisa jogar como grupo. Libertadores se vence com força coletiva, não com nomes”, comentou.

Expectativa para o confronto com o Racing

O duelo desta quarta-feira é considerado um dos mais importantes da temporada rubro-negra. O Maracanã deve receber um grande público, e a torcida espera uma vitória que dê tranquilidade para o jogo de volta, marcado para o estádio El Cilindro, em Avellaneda.

Arrascaeta e Pedro são as principais esperanças ofensivas da equipe. Ambos vivem excelente fase e foram decisivos na vitória sobre o Palmeiras no fim de semana. O meia e o atacante marcaram os gols que mantiveram o Flamengo na briga pelo título do Brasileirão.

Em contrapartida, o técnico Filipe Luís ainda tem dúvidas no setor defensivo. O zagueiro Léo Ortiz, que sofreu uma lesão na perna direita, tenta se recuperar a tempo e pode ser incluído na lista de relacionados. Já Cebolinha está fora da partida, ainda em tratamento no departamento médico.
